We had a wonderful stay at Riu Jalisco. The property while a bit older is beautifully designed and we really liked how spacious the outdoor areas were. The service was excellent. We stayed in a family suite, which gives you two bedrooms and two bathrooms, a little bar area, a separate little living room with a TV, and a spaces balcony. Each bedroom had a large king size bed, the one bedroom is sort of the general area that you will walk through to get to any of the other rooms. It was perfect for family of 4 plus grandma. There are five restaurants. Regular huge buffet with everything, a Mexican buffet, an Asian buffet, and Italian buffet, and a steakhouse where you order off a set menu. Service at the steakhouse is very slow, it took an hour to get our steaks. We definitely preferred the other restaurants. Overall service was so great, there are lots of bars all over the place, you can get espresso coffees at the sports bar in the morning, or anytime of day really. Tipping goes a long way. the beach is beautiful, there are a lot of palm trees that offer shaded areas to lounge in, there are two adult pools, one with a swim up bar. There are two awesome kid pools, with lots of fun features and slides. There’s also a kids club. We never used it, but it looked like it was a good option for those who would like to drop off the kiddos and have some adult time. Every night had some fun entertainment for both kids and adults. All in all it was an absolutely perfect vacation for us.
